Symptoms of carpal passage can consist of tingling, numbness, and burning in the fingers. In addition to the inability to make a hand or hold points. An individual at some point loses the ability to squeeze points. It also might even discover it tough to tie their shoes. In the most difficult situations of repetitive strain injury, the individuals cannot identify warm or chilly by touch.
Therapy is readily available. Extension workouts and medications like corticosteroids can assist in alleviating the syndrome.
